Note: We have organized the cemeteries in our Gazetteer based on a problem that we had while working on our own genealogy. As an example and without specifying the cemeteries involved, we found an ancestor that we believed to have been buried in one cemetery had actually been buried elsewhere.
We discovered that his burial plans had changed at the last moment and the family had scrambled to make new arrangements. By looking at nearby cemeteries, the surrounding communities and in newspapers of the period, we were finally able to locate his burial site.
Should you find yourself in the same situation, we hope that our Gazetteer helps you discover your lost ancestor.
The Location of the Rochester Station Cemetery ...
We are using the following GPS coordinates (latitude and longitude) for the Rochester Station Cemetery:
41.1287, -82.3077
Note: The GPS location that we are using for the Rochester Station Cemetery can be traced back to the Geographic Names Information System (GNIS)<1>
The Rochester Station Cemetery is located in Lorain County<2>.
The county seat for Lorain County is located in Elyria. Elyria lies 19 miles [30.6 km]<3> to the north northeast of the Rochester Station Cemetery .

- Referenced GNIS Record ...
- GNIS ID #1963563 (Rochester Station Cemetery)
- Note: In 2021, GNIS record #1963563 was archived by the USGS. It is no longer maintained by the USGS, nor can it be retrieved from their website. In the past, the GNIS record contained the following information:
- BGN Class: cemetery
- County: Lorain
- Est. Elev: 283 (in feet)
- Topo Map Name: Brighton
- Location given for Rochester Station Cemetery:
- Lat: 41.1286647 Lon: -82.3076626
